Jennifer Rodger
Bio
Professor Jennifer Rodger is Head of Brain Plasticity Research at the Perron Institute and a Senior Research Fellow at UWA. She holds a BSc (Hons) in Biochemistry from the University of Bath and a PhD in Molecular Neuroscience from the University Pierre et Marie Curie, France. Her research focuses on brain plasticity, neural regeneration, and non-invasive brain stimulation techniques.
Meeting for Minds involvement
Professor Rodger is the Principal Investigator for the SYNERGIES program at the Perron Institute, a collaborative initiative with Meeting for Minds. The program explores the effects of rep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S) on brain plasticity, involving participants with lived experience in the research process.

Featured Research & Work
Investigates mechanisms of brain plasticity and repair, including studies on non-invasive brain stimulation in injured and abnormal brain circuits.
Co-leads the Neuropharmacogenetics project at the Perron Institute.
